The Medical Writing Market is entering a new phase of technological transformation as artificial intelligence, natural language generation, and automated content management systems augment human medical writing capabilities while raising fundamental questions about quality, accountability, and the future of the profession. Large language models trained on vast corpora of medical literature, regulatory documents, and clinical data can now generate draft content, suggest regulatory-compliant language, and automate routine documentation tasks that previously consumed substantial writer time. Machine learning algorithms for data extraction, table generation, and cross-referencing are reducing manual error and improving document consistency across complex submissions. The integration of these technologies is enabling medical writing teams to handle higher volumes, meet aggressive timelines, and focus human expertise on strategic, interpretive, and creative aspects of documentation.
